Hi all,
this patchset adds a new metadata version 2, which brings the following
improvements:
- UUIDs and labels: Adding three more fields to the metadata containing
the dm-zoned device UUID and label, and the device UUID. This allows
for an unique identification of the devices, so that several dm-zoned
sets can coexist and have a persistent identification.
- Extend random zones by an additional regular disk device: A regular
block device can be added together with the zoned block device, providing
additional (emulated) random write zones. With this it's possible to
handle sequential zones only devices; also there will be a speed-up if
the regular block device resides on a fast medium. The regular block device
is placed logically in front of the zoned block device, so that metadata
and mapping tables reside on the regular block device, not the zoned device.
- Tertiary superblock support: In addition to the two existing sets of metadata
another, tertiary, superblock is written to the first block of the zoned
block device. This superblock is for identification only; the generation
number is set to '0' and the block itself it never updated. The additional
metadate like bitmap tables etc are not copied.
To handle this, some changes to the original handling are introduced:
- Zones are now equidistant. Originally, runt zones were ignored, and
not counted when sizing the mapping tables. With the dual device setup
runt zones might occur at the end of the regular block device, making
direct translation between zone number and sector/block number complex.
For metadata version 2 all zones are considered to be of the same size,
and runt zones are simply marked as 'offline' to have them ignored when
allocating a new zone.
- The block number in the superblock is now the global number, and refers to
the location of the superblock relative to the resulting device-mapper
device. Which means that the tertiary superblock contains absolute block
addresses, which needs to be translated to the relative device addresses
to find the referenced block.
There is an accompanying patchset for dm-zoned-tools for writing and checking
this new metadata.
